Undated (Circa 1910). 320pp, eight colour plates (including frontispiece). Blue cloth-covered boards, tipped-in colour illustrations on front and spine, black titles on front and spine. 8vo. Wear to boards and spine. Spine discoloured. Bumped spine ends, cloth worn. Bumps to board edges; small cloth loss bottom front. Corners bumped; cloth rubbed. Text block edges stained blue. Decorative endpapers tanning. Minor foxing to prelim pages. Internally neat, clean, bright and tight, barring very occasional foxing.
Book self-described as illustrating the "qualities by which our countrymen have maintained and strengthened the British rule in India".
